Hired a bike in France for 3 weeks;  a bit of a nightmare.  Soooo much more expensive than a car.  Be mindful to avoid the mistake I made:  I'd told them the duration of my trip, and simply multiplied the cheapest rate (the weekly) times three.  Upon return, I was told I owed another $1400, since longer rentals reverted to the higher rates.  Lucky for me (?)  1) I dealt with a human being upon my return,  and 2) the bike had proved such a nightmarish piece of shite that he called it even (and I assumed the costs of a front bearing job and replacing a puncture-repaired tire that gave out).  If the bike had been a gem, I'd have paid twice as much!  I had tried to find a cheap bike on-line before flying over, figuring that, if I failed to sell it upon leaving, I could give some kid the keys and papers and walk away.
